micro clase 1
TRANSCRIPT
![Page 1: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/1.jpg)
Microprocesadores
UCH – 2012 Ing. Jose Benites Yarleque
![Page 2: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/2.jpg)
Docente: Ing. José Valerio Benites YarlequéE-mail: [email protected].: 976880302Horario: Lunes [20:40 – 22:00]pm Jueves [18:00 - 19:20]pm Número de Prácticas Calificadas: 4Laboratorios: 4Examen parcial: EPExamen final: EFProyecto
![Page 3: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/3.jpg)
Objetivos
• Describir la arquitectura interna de los Microprocesadores de 8, 16 y 32 bits
• Analizar el funcionamiento de un microprocesador• Realizar programas en bajo nivel para Microprocesadores• Programar interfaces para Microprocesadores• Realizar programas en Macroassembler
![Page 4: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/4.jpg)
Evaluación
![Page 5: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/5.jpg)
Evaluación
![Page 6: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/6.jpg)
Software y Web
• Debug• emu8086• Masm • C++
![Page 7: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/7.jpg)
Introducción
• I.- ENIAC• Primer Computador Electrónico digital
![Page 8: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/8.jpg)
ENIAC
• Electronic Numerical Integrator and Computer• • Surgido en EEUU por la II Guerra Mundial• – 17.500 válvulas• – 7.200 diodos• – 1.500 relés• – 70.000 resistencias• – 10.000 condensadores• – 5 millones de puntos de soldadura• – 25 toneladas• – 200 metros cuadrados• – 150 kW de energía• – Medio millón de dólares
• • Construida por John Mauchly y J. Presper Eckert
![Page 9: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/9.jpg)
ENIAC
• Usaba el sistema decimal y no el binario• Tenía que ser reprogramada• – Llevaba semanas trasladar el problema a la• máquina• – Llevaba días ajustar interruptores y cables• • Los datos de entrada se proveían con• tarjetas• • Tenía impresora de salida
![Page 10: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/10.jpg)
Sistema digital basado en un Microprocesador
• 5 Buses
• 4 periféricos
1 Procesador moria2 Memoria
3 Controlador I / O
![Page 11: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/11.jpg)
Microprocesador
• Un microprocesador es un circuito integrado con alta tecnología de integración, que es controlado por programas, emplea un conjunto de instrucciones, y a partir de un conjunto de datos de entrada procesa información, genera señales de control del sistema. En un sistema digital basado en un microprocesador se requiere el empleo de otros componentes como memoria EPROM, SRAM, DRAM, circuitos integrados interfaces para la conexión de periféricos de entrada y salida.
![Page 12: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/12.jpg)
Microprocesador
![Page 13: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/13.jpg)
Partes de un Procesador
![Page 14: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/14.jpg)
Partes de un Microprocesador
• Registros
• ALU
• Unidad de control
• Buses internos
• Buses externos
![Page 15: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/15.jpg)
Registros
![Page 16: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/16.jpg)
ALU
![Page 17: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/17.jpg)
Unidad de control
![Page 18: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/18.jpg)
Buses de comunicaciones
• Bus de direcciones
• Bus de datos
• Bus de control
![Page 19: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/19.jpg)
Evolución de los Microprocesadores
• Procesadores de 4 bits
• Procesadores de 8 bits
• Procesadores de 16 bits
• Procesadores de 32 bits
• Procesadores de 64 bits
![Page 20: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/20.jpg)
![Page 21: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/21.jpg)
![Page 22: Micro Clase 1](https://reader034.vdocuments.pub/reader034/viewer/2022052307/557210ac497959fc0b8d8721/html5/thumbnails/22.jpg)